En quoi l’interface mod_lsapi est-elle meilleur que PHP-FPM ?

13 Juin 2022

Le mod_lsapi est le moyen le plus rapide et le plus fiable de servir des pages PHP. Il s’agit d’un remplaçant à PHP-FPM, SuPHP, FastCGI, etc. Ce module Apache est basé sur l’API LiteSpeed Technologies, pour PHP.

LSAPI, des avantages par rapport à PHP-FPM !

Tout d’abord, mod_lsapi est beaucoup plus rapide. Il utilise le modèle de programmation asynchrone événementiel haute performance de LiteSpeed Technologies pour obtenir une faible latence et un débit élevé. mod_lsapi peut traiter plus de deux fois plus de requêtes que PHP-FPM.mod_lsapi est également plus fiable. Il est conçu pour être léger et avoir une faible empreinte mémoire. Par conséquent, mod_lsapi est moins susceptible de tomber en panne en raison de fuites de mémoire ou d’autres problèmes

Enfin, mod_lsapi est plus facile à configurer. Il ne nécessite pas de fichiers de configuration ou de paramètres particuliers.

mod_lsapi (lsapi) vs php-fpm
mod_lsapi vs php fpm

Le module Apache mod_lsapi est un module API PHP LiteSpeed Technologies. Il offre d’excellentes performances, une faible consommation de mémoire et la prise en charge de la mise en cache des opcodes, en plus d’une sécurité et d’une assistance complètes. Nous avons obtenu des performances supérieures à celles de mod_php en utilisant LSAPI, ainsi qu’une installation plus facile que php-fpm et une intégration avec n’importe quel panneau de contrôle. Plus rapide

Dans cette discussion, vous avez affirmé que lors d’une comparaison directe du traitement de scripts PHP dynamiques (non mis en cache), LSAPI était plus rapide que PHP-FPM.

LSAPI / mod_lsapi

mod_lsapi (LSAPI) est un nouveau gestionnaire qui a été introduit pour cPanel/EasyApache 4 après avoir été précédemment disponible uniquement pour les serveurs CloudLinux. mod_lsapi PRO (avec des options de configuration supplémentaires) est accessible pour les serveurs DirectAdmin et cPanel/WHM avec CloudLinux installé.

mod_lsapi est basé sur le gestionnaire standard lsphp de LiteSpeed. mod_lsapi peut être utilisé à la place de tout autre gestionnaire (CGI, SuPHP, FCGID, ou DSO). Il est considéré comme le gestionnaire le plus efficace actuellement disponible. Il consomme un minimum de ressources à la fois sur la mémoire du serveur et sur le CPU.

L’inconvénient est que, contrairement à la version complète de LSAPI (qui n’est pas prise en charge par CloudLinux), CRIU (Checkpoint/Restore In Userspace) et le pooling de connexion sont désactivés. Avec mod_lsapi PRO, vous pourrez profiter pleinement de LSAPI si vous utilisez CloudLinux.

Le gestionnaire LSAPI peut être utilisé dans un environnement multi-PHP à toutes les versions.

Points forts de cette interface PHP :

  • Rapide par rapport aux autres interfaces PHP
  • Aucune configuration complexe requise
  • Fonctionne avec la mise en cache PHP via OPCache
  • Supporte les Directives PHP dans les fichiers .htaccess (php_flag or php_value)
  • Consomme peu de mémoire RAM et de CPU
  • Exécute les scripts PHP en tant qu’utilisateur Linux final (sécurité)

Désavantages de LSAPI / mod_lsapi :

  • Des autorisations de fichiers inadéquates peuvent conduire à une situation de lecture universelle, posant des problèmes de sécurité pour tous vos sites web.

0 commentaires

Soumettre un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*

Ce site utilise Akismet pour réduire les indésirables. En savoir plus sur comment les données de vos commentaires sont utilisées.

EasyHoster.business.site : l’actualité d’un hébergeur web

EasyHoster.business.site : l’actualité d’un hébergeur web

EasyHoster est la Solution d’Hébergement cPanel, avec Support WordPress, dédiée à ceux qui recherchent Bien plus qu’un hébergeur. Le mini-site easyhoster.business.site publie régulièrement, l’actualité de l’Hébergeur Web… malheureusement, il n’est pas possible de remonter dans les très anciennes actualités, sur le mini-site de l’Hébergeur WordPress (EasyHoster), propulsé par Google My Business.

lire plus